The Art of Open Concept Design: Creating Fluid Spaces for Modern Living

Open concept design has emerged as a dominant force in modern architecture, redefining the way we perceive and utilize space within our homes. This design trend eliminates many of the traditional barriers found in conventional layouts, promoting an environment that is simultaneously functional and inviting. At its core, open concept living focuses on creating interconnected spaces that allow for free movement and natural light. This design philosophy not only enhances the aesthetic appeal of a home but also improves its functionality. For families, this means the ability to multitask while maintaining visibility across different activity zones. For example, parents can cook dinner in the kitchen while keeping an eye on children playing in the living room, fostering an inclusive and connected family atmosphere.

One of the primary methods to achieve an open concept space is to remove non-essential interior walls. This approach can open up areas such as the living room, dining area, and kitchen, seamlessly blending them into one expansive zone. Such spaces often become the heart of the home, perfect for entertaining guests or unwinding after a long day. The choice of materials and finishes in these shared areas can further accentuate unity. Consistent flooring, neutral color palettes, and cohesive furniture styles are key elements that prevent these open spaces from feeling disjointed.

In addition to altering physical structures, integrating innovative design elements can significantly enhance the open concept experience. Installing large windows or sliding glass doors can bring the outside in, flooding the space with natural light and creating an illusion of even more space. Such features can beautifully frame your backyard or garden, making nature a part of your living space. Strategic lighting fixtures, such as pendant lights or recessed lighting, can be used to highlight specific zones within an open area, adding depth and functionality.

Maximizing storage solutions is another crucial aspect of successful open concept design. To maintain a clutter-free environment, incorporating built-in storage solutions like shelves, cabinets, or multifunctional furniture is essential. These solutions can store everyday items discreetly, ensuring that the open areas remain tidy and spacious.

For homeowners concerned about losing the cozy or defined nature of individual rooms, transitional spaces such as partitions or islands can offer visual boundaries without sacrificing openness. These elements, whether in the form of low walls, bookshelves, or kitchen islands, serve as informal dividers and add character and functionality to the open space.

In contemporary living, open concept design is more than a trend; it's a lifestyle choice catering to modern needs for flexibility, connection, and efficiency. By adopting this approach, homes become adaptable to various activities, enhancing the way we live, interact, and thrive within our spaces.
